Babcock ties for Eastman golf title
LA CROSSE, Wis. - Will Babcock of Kirkwood tied for first place at the Ronnie Eastman Invitational at the La Crosse Country Club Tuesday.
Babcock competed as an individual and did not count in the team standings for the Eagles. He fired rounds of 75 and 73 for a 36-hole total of 148, tying Isaac Westlake of Winona State and Ben Phipps of Luther for the title on the par-72 course.
Ryan Morrison of Kirkwood tied for fourth place to help Kirkwood finish in second place in the team standings. He shot rounds of 76 and 74 for a 36-hole score 150, just two shots behind the leaders.
Winona State won the team championship at 603. Kirkwood placed second at 610, seven shots off the lead.
